7 ways to set effective boundaries during the holidays

Shopping, cooking, a million holiday parties. In order to get it done—and actually enjoy yourself—you’ll need to be extra ruthless about prioritizing the important things. Here’s how. It’s touted as the most wonderful time of year, but for most professionals, it’s more like the most chaotic quarter of all. As time management expert and best-selling author Julie Morgenstern puts it, there is a stark contradiction between the image of the holidays as an all-relaxing, warm and fuzzy time, and the reality of the pressure coming from every direction.Read Full Story Continue reading at 'Fast Company'

EDC Sets Another Record

Earnings jumped 139% in the third quarter ended November 30, 2015 over last year's third period at Educational Development Corp. Profits were $1.2 million in the most recent quarter and were driven by a 123% increase in revenue, which rose to $24.4 million. Continue reading at Publishers Weekly

Holiday Comp Sales Rose at B&N

Comparable store sales rose 0.6% at Barnes & Noble over the nine-week holiday period that ended January 2, 2016. Excluding sales of Nook products, comp sales were up 1.6%. Continue reading at Publishers Weekly
